Chapter 62: Dogs See Meat and Bones
"That man looked at you like a dog at a bone. What did you say to him?"
Gu Yu didn't look back and said nonchalantly: "Guess."
"I won't guess. If you guess wrong, you'll call me a fool in your heart. I won't give you this chance."
"You actually knew that?" Gu Yu was surprised.
An Yun yelled, "You often look at me like I'm stupid, but I'm not blind."
But she has always been generous and doesn't bother with them.
In Tingchao Courtyard, An Yun said excitedly:
"That's the cream boy."
"That's called a cream boy." Zhao Mingzhu corrected her. When did she ever say the word cream boy?
The difference of one word changed the taste. Zhao Mingzhu thought of the cream boy and the spicy prince...
"Anyway, I think he definitely has feelings for our princess. It's as if the princess would just wave and he would come running over with his tail wagging."
Zhao Mingzhu slapped her thigh and said, "It's so clever! I wasn't there, what a pity I didn't see it."
She glanced at Gu Yu out of the corner of her eye, then recalled Bo Ling. The two of them still looked compatible.
Gu Yu stood aside, listening to the two people whispering, and said unhappily:
"You two still have time to talk nonsense. Don't you think about the seriousness of this incident? You, my sister-in-law, almost became a sacrifice."
Zhao Mingzhu came back to her senses. She was also innocent:
"This is an unexpected disaster. No matter how much I pay attention to it, I can't avoid it."
Gu Yu crossed his arms and said, "Do you really think it was an accident? Then why did I hear that someone was caught at the horse farm and the body was already cold?"
Zhao Mingzhu was stunned after hearing this: "Who gave the order?"
"My brother, his men went to the horse farm and within a few minutes they had captured a eunuch. They said he had a grudge against you and was filled with resentment, so they drove a nail through the horse's hoof to drive it mad, creating the illusion that you had died accidentally."
Zhao Mingzhu had actually guessed this, and she suddenly remembered the dead mouse in her textbook.
Then, Zhao Mingzhu shrugged: "It seems that there are indeed many people who want to kill me."
Gu Yu stared at her: "Do you think that eunuch is the mastermind?"
Zhao Mingzhu's domineering behavior is as easy as eating and drinking water. There are indeed many people who hate her, but in recent years, only this eunuch has actually taken action against her.
"Maybe yes, maybe not." Zhao Mingzhu stretched lazily and answered casually.
Gu Yu really couldn't bear to see this man's carelessness, and choked:
"If you're so careless and one day your head and body are torn apart, I won't even go to your funeral. Giving you a tattered mat is the best way to preserve our friendship."
An Yun looked around at the two of them. Who should she speak up for?
An Yun selected the troops and generals in her mind and finally decided who to help.
"Gu Yu, is it possible that Mingzhu is not indifferent? Even if she is, there is nothing we can do. Her brain is only slightly smarter than mine. She is also completely clueless about such a complicated matter."
Zhao Mingzhu tilted her head to look at An Yun, smiling with tears in her eyes:
"Anzi still understands me, but next time, can you please not compare yourself with me?"
Gu Yu really felt frustrated, especially when she saw that these two people were quite self-aware, she felt even more frustrated.
Even scolding them seemed to make her seem inconsiderate.
"I'm too lazy to tell you. I'm going back to the palace."
Gu Yu's skirt twirled as she ignored them and went back to sort out the people who hated Zhao Mingzhu.
After a long time, Gu Yu had no choice but to give up. It was just too much.
The line can reach the city gate.
…
Seeing that Gu Yu was about to leave, An Yun also stood up: "Aren't you going to say goodbye to Creamy Xiaofang?"
"He's a pretty boy."
Zhao Mingzhu corrected it again from behind.
Gu Yu left without looking back, and An Yun followed closely behind. Zhao Mingzhu watched them leave.
Then the playful smile on his face faded.
"Qiao'er, prepare something for me. I'll need it in a while."
After nightfall, a man in black appeared outside the stable, bent over and sneaked in, and then saw a pool of blood in the stable.
The man in black trembled as he took out paper money and incense sticks:
"I'm sorry for implicating you. Don't blame me even if you go to hell." Fortunately, he owed him a life, so he refused to give him up.
But just as she blew the fire stick, a person jumped out from the surroundings, and the man in black was stunned... Changhe, the prince's attendant.
The man in black retreated in panic and turned around to run away, but Changhe moved like lightning, grabbed his shoulder and threw him against the wooden pillar.
The man in black covered his chest and tried hard not to make any sound, but the severe pain still made him groan.
"Sure enough, there is a mastermind." Changhe reached out to pull away the black veil.
The man in black's eyes were gray. It was over, everything was over.
But suddenly a nimble figure appeared, blocked Chang He, and started fighting with him.
Changhe broke free from the fight. The other party threw a smoke ball, stepped back, picked up the half-dead person lying on the ground, jumped onto the roof and ran away.
When Changhe chased after them, the two had already disappeared.
In the quiet alley late at night, the night watchman passed by and said: "It's dry, be careful with fire..."
"Ahem." The man in black grabbed the collar of his shirt and could faintly taste a sweet and fishy smell.
I'm afraid I was seriously injured after falling in Changhe.
But what worries me most right now is whether this person is a friend or an enemy? Why did he save me?
"When we get there, I'll drop you off here. It's already very close to your home."
The man's voice was hoarse, but he said something scary.
"How do you know my family? Who are you?" Su Lu couldn't help but asked.
But the other party jumped on the roof and said: "This is not something you should know. Just know that you and I have the same enemy."
Su Lu took two steps forward. She was unwilling to let the other party know everything while she knew nothing.
But that person had already disappeared and his whereabouts were unknown.
“Damn it!”
Su Lu stamped her feet in anger. She didn't feel happy at all about surviving the disaster. She just felt a chill on her back.
She couldn't sleep or eat because such a handle on her fell into the hands of someone whose origin she had no idea about.
But there was no way at the moment, Su Lu quickly took off the black clothes and put them into the bag.
At this time, a carriage passed by, and Lei Ruoshui saw her when he was bored.
"Lulu, why are you here?"
It was already very late and she had just returned from Li Can's house. Unexpectedly, she ran into Su Lu.
Su Lu reluctantly said, "I couldn't sleep, so I sneaked out to relax."
This statement was really untenable, and Lei Ruoshui was careless and didn't care: "Hurry up and come up, I'll take you home later."
Su Lu smiled shyly: "Thank you Ruoshui."
She struggled to climb onto Lei Ruoshui's carriage. Lei Ruoshui patted her shoulder without a second thought and said casually:
"Really? Why are you being so polite to me?"
The pain in her chest caused Su Lu to twist her face:
"...Yes, Ruoshui, you are so kind."
Lei Ruoshui waited for her to sit down and then talked about what happened today:
"Luckily, I was able to find the Imperial Guards in time. An Yun must come to my house with a generous gift and thank me in person!"
Otherwise, Zhao Mingzhu might have been injured.
Su Lu forced a smile after hearing this, but it didn't show in her eyes:
"Ruoshui, haven't we always been at odds with them? Why are you helping Zhao Mingzhu?"
Lei Ruoshui didn't even think about it: "But it's not to the point of watching her die."
They did argue with each other, but that was all.
If she were to die one day, she believed that An Yun and the others would not stand by and watch her die.
After all, they hated each other over the years, but the most they had ever done was a fight.
"Well, Ruoshui, you are so kind."
Su Lu's expression was cold. If it weren't for Lei Ruoshui's help, Zhao Mingzhu might have really died today.
